首页 \ 问答 \ 学Java好吗?

学Java好吗?

不知道学.Net好,还是Java好?
更新时间:2022-05-16 13:05

最满意答案

我不知道你怎么想
首先要有兴趣~~
其实java没传说中的难学,要多想 多做例子~~慢慢的很多不明白的你就会明白了
而.net很容易上手 但是局限太大 值限于WINDOW平台~~呵呵

其他回答

java  。.net这个,好吧   知道的少
现在学java的人太多了,很多人学了都找不到工作,而且学这个的学费还不低,像现在培训学校太多了,一个城市至少有几十家培训学校,一个城市5个左右的分校,每月开班三四个,每个班30多,有的培训一年,有的半年算一下,一年一个城市有多少人在学这个,粗略估计一个城市一年就一万个学java的,我已经体会了这种供少于求的工作,我刚从某培训机构出来,竞争力相当的大,找工作很难,现在java程序员越来越不值钱了
学java的好处就是工资高,哈哈。比.net高。但是好像.net的岗位比java多。
学java是做程序员的入门还是不错的。进门以后再多方面、全方面发展。总之做程序员就是要不断学习
如果可以的话,都学, 而且要精, 学就学好, 学更深!!
我个人觉得java/J2EE、.net、嵌入式开发是不错的三个方向。 
如果非要在java和.net中选择的话,我个人是推荐java的,原因: 
1:Java能够开发linux、unix服务器上的程序 
2:JavaEE和.NET在企业应用方面的关注点是差不多的,但是学习了java如果将来想转到.net上会比较简单,几天的学习然后上手开发应该是问题不大的,但是反之就不行了。 当然如果有了些经验之后,你就会发现语言或者平台不再是技术上的阻碍,一些原理性的东西学到手,然后再加上项目经验,使用什么平台,反而不是最重要的。不过如果非要用一种平台进入企业开发的领域,至少在目前,我推荐java。

其实新手要想学JAVA 也不难 
关键是要坚持 
多看看视频 多编写代码
一年之后 
相信你会个差不多的 
我给你推荐个网站上面有尚学堂马士兵的学习过程 很经典 
而且上面有很多资料还有一整套尚学堂视频 
下面这两个网站就有
http://www.ibeifeng.com/?u=6695  
http://bbs.langsin.com/index.php?fromuid=29811
简单谈下java的学习心得 
文章来源:中国电脑教程网 文章作者:hemee 发布时间:2007-03-01 

我在Java 1.0正式问世前就开始学习Java,这么多年过去了,到现在我的Java学习历程还没有停过。我阅读原文书,研究原始码,撰写程序,自认为走得扎实,不奢望一步登天。像我这样老式的学习方式,显然和现在的快餐主义背道而驰。从许多读者的来信和学生的反应中,我发现大多数的人对于Java的学习历程都差不多是:因为公司需要使用Java来进行服务器的计画,所以急急忙忙地学习Java语言,然后就开始使用J2EE的API,开始写起程序来了。如此急就章的学习方式,程序员基础能力根本就不够,对于对象导向精髓不能掌握,对于Java语言内部的运作机制毫无所悉,对API的整体连贯性懵懵懂懂。 


当然,我们也不好因此责怪程序员,毕竟软件技术变动得太快。公司不可能给程序员足够的训练之后才开始做计画。程序员一下子被指派使用A技术,还没弄懂A技术是怎么回事,又被指派使用B技术,而且都是缝缝补补的方式边学边用,每次都像是全新的开始,遑论技术能量的累积。 

我很庆幸的是,我不太有这样的困扰。因为我是资讯工程系出身(而且我大学时上课一向很认真),所以理论基础稳固,学习新技术对我来说不是难事。我就读大学时,周遭许多同学都瞧不起数据结构、程序语言、操作系统这些所谓「学院派」的课程,以为这些课程一点都不实用。他们认为到了外面公司,这些信息科系所学的一切都派不上用场,「只要会Visual Basic和数据库就够了」。这种偏差的心态,恐怕会使得他们在知识经济时代吃足了苦头。 

另外还有一派同学很瞧不起程序设计工作,他们告诉我,像我这样会写程序的人,未来进了社会「还不是被他们这些走管理的人踩在脚下」。所以,他们很轻忽理工课程的学习,甚至还有人相当热衷「成功学」,认为这是迈向成功的快捷方式,却因此把学校的课业弃之不顾。我不敢相信有人竟然如此地本末倒置。 

前一类的人太过于短视近利,后一类的人太过于好高骛远。我一直很不能理解这些人的想法为什么会这样,或许是因为社会环境的风气使然。我很庆幸我到目前还没被社会的大染缸给玷污了(最好这辈子都不要)。我不认为我的学习方式是一种典范,但是一路走来,倒也颇有进展。许多读者来信问我的学习历程,虽然我个人的学习方式不见得适用于每个人,但或许还有一些参考价值(特别是对于那些有志进入信息行业的年轻学子),我想透过本文简短地叙述一下。 

我一向是采用先深后广(也称为Bottom-Up,Deep-First)的学习方式。比方说,当我在学A技术的时候,学到一半发现需要B技术的基础,我会到书局找出一两本B技术的书,然后把A先搁着,开始看起B技术的书。甚至,我在技术书籍上看到不太熟悉的英文句构时,我会找出一本英文文法书详细读过。这种先深后广的学习方式,适合学生时代全面地自我能力提升,但不适合业界人士。试想,老板要你开发的ERP系统已经延迟了,你怎有空研究J2EE原文书中的英文文法。先深后广的好处是,学习很扎实;缺点是有时候会偏离主题太多。有一次我发现我原本是要学某软件技术,几次「先深后广」下来,我居然看起老子的道德经了。 

在技术上,我一直都是一个喜新厌旧的人,很少有软件技术能让我持续研究半年以上,我几乎每隔几个月就要换一次领域。Java 能让我持续这么久,也正是因为Java的领域广。透过Java,我的技术视野变开阔了。这些年来,我换过的 Java 相关领域包括了:虚拟机器、数据库、企业运算、多媒体、2D/3D图学、网络.…..等。 

我的学习完全是兴趣导向的,所以压力并不大。因为有兴趣,所以我会很想充分理解一切细节。又因为理解,所以许多原本片片断断的知识都可以渐渐互相融会贯通,累积技术能量,理论和实务之间的藩篱被打破了,学习效率倍增。 

我多年来的学习触觉很敏锐,我常常会抢先一步学好有前瞻性的技术。比方说,Java还在beta时、UML还在0.8时、XML还在draft时,我都已经透过网络下载技术文件回来每天抱着猛读了。而在Java、UML、XML当红之后,我已经差不多把这些技术都摸熟了。 

至于该学什么技术,我的判断方式是以技术的优劣来决定。优秀而有独到之处的技术是我的最爱,虽然这类的技术不见得会在市场上胜出,但学习这些技术所得到的启发,对于技术能量的累积与能力的提升会有相当大的助益。至于技术差,但市场需求甚殷者,我还是懒得碰。(好吧!我承认我曾因为市场需求的缘故而学过MFC。越清楚MFC的技术细节,越是讨厌它,这真是个不堪回首的经验。) 

我通常只看英文技术资料,毕竟大部分第一手的技术信息都是以英文来传播。所以我很早就开始阅读英文技术资料。读英文技术资料的好处是,就算没有学到书中的专业知识,至少也累积培养了英文阅读能力,我一直都是抱着这样的态度。一开始是正襟危坐的看英文技术书籍,字典、翻译机随侍在侧;几年下来,现在是躺着看、趴着看、很随性地看英文技术书籍,因为看英文技术书籍变成一种习惯了。现在,我可以用很快的速度吸收英文技术书籍的知识(有人叫我「吃书的机器」,我把这称号当作是一种恭维)。 

近年来,我花在写程序的时间不多,因为时间对我来说很宝贵,而写程序很浪费时间。对初学者来说,大量地写程序是必要的,但过了某个阶段之后,写程序所带来的技术能力成长已经到了极限,还不如多花一点时间看书,学新技术和新观念。 

我从国小时期开始学习写程序,迄今已有近十八年的时间;采取上述的方式密集学习,迄今也有近十年的光景。迩来数年,我接触的领域越来越广,而且学习速度正在加快,我认为是以前那些努力植下的根苗开始成长了。看看现在的我,或许你会觉得羡慕,但回顾这段学习的岁月,何尝不是一条漫长的道路。
看你个人喜好,只要学精了,都可以
java主要做系统,.net主要做网站,看自己的偏好了。
我感觉只要有兴趣 什么都能学会  要看自己到底是不是喜欢 肯不肯去努力

相关问答

更多
  • 我就是自己学习出来的,我身边有朋友是培训的,我总结了一下: 自己学习的话,如果你对java兴趣好的话,我觉得那是一段很快乐的时光,但是也累,但是过得充实,每天为了学习心理踏实,学习出来了,(前提是你要努力学习),你对知识的记忆。。。很强,是忘记不到的,因为那你是苦出来的, 对于培训,也还是可以,每天按照老师的步骤学习,但是学费贵啊,差不多1万吧,我了解了哈各个培训学校,有的更贵,学习出来也可以找到工作,据我所知中山大学软件人才培训中心做的是正规项目,我建议你不想自学的话还是自己学习去那参加培训吧!那样你更充 ...
  • 在部队学计算机技术跟不上外面的时代,除非你学完任然在部队工作,建议你可以学个维修什么的,现在车多,学个修车,现在4s店修个车很贵的。出来拿着部队津贴还能开个店。
  • 目前学电脑呀 现在是比较热门的 将来的就业发展空间也是比较大的 短期培训成就实战人才
  • 想的话我劝你还是打住吧,黑客也就是所谓的网络安全工程师,你一个女孩子真的不好坚持下去的。还不如当一只萌萌哒的程序员,不用管太多,安安静静的敲代码就好。
  • 学Java好吗?[2022-05-16]

    我不知道你怎么想 首先要有兴趣~~ 其实java没传说中的难学,要多想 多做例子~~慢慢的很多不明白的你就会明白了 而.net很容易上手 但是局限太大 值限于WINDOW平台~~呵呵
  • 先看看《java编程思想》(thinking in java)吧。 多动手练习,可以找些实际的小程序来练手。 搭建环境,先下个JDK装上,然后下个eclipse做开发IDE。最好再找份JDK API的文档。
  • 1、从发展前景、未来主导看,C语言更有前途一些。因为C语言是继机器码、汇编之后第一个底层的与自然语言接近的语言,兼顾高效率与易理解,所以做底层的主流语言C的地位永远不会改变。java是面向对象的高级语言,主要目的是容易理解和编写代码,那么将来肯定会出现更加人性化的高级语言来取代它。 2、这个结论从C语言出现的几十年但一直居于编程语言排行榜的前三名就可以证明。从优势和就业来看,java目前好一点,java是面向对象的高级语言,所以应用软件主要使用它,相比较C擅长的底层开发,应用软件的市场更大一些,所以也更容易 ...
  • 学java好吗[2021-06-27]

    语言的本身本来就没有好坏之分的;关键是看用作什么开发、什么用处的; 想依赖微软Windows 系统的呢,可以使用C#、C++等等,用微软的语言的话,有好处,就是背后有强大的类库支持你,就像framework 框架类库;很少跨平台操作,不过,现在这个说法也被打破了,比如说:C#语言+Mono就可以实现跨平台了~ java语言是跨平台的语言,用它你可以写出适用于大多数的操作系统平台的应用程序。 综合来说,学习java出去的比较牛~ 路过~希望可以帮助 你~
  • 不会,你重心放在一门语言上就好了,比如你想学ruby,那么就专心的去啃他,java只是了解就可以,精通一门,熟悉多门,另外,你可以把java的一些好的编程方法应用到ruby上